Brian Wilson - O Holy Night Lyrics




O Holy Night! The stars are brightly shining,
It is the night of our dear Saviour's birth.
Long lay the world in sin and error pining.
Till He appeared and the soul felt its worth.
A thrill of hope the weary soul rejoices,
For yonder breaks a new and glorious morn.
Fall on your knees! Oh, hear the angel voices!
O night divine, o night when Christ was born;
O night divine, O Holy Night!

Led by the light of faith serenely beaming,
With glowing hearts by His cradle we stand.
So led by light a star is sweetly gleaming,
Become the wise men from the Orient land.
The King of kings lay thus the lowly manger;
In all our trials born to be our friends.
He knows our need, to weakness is no stranger,
Behold you the King!
O night when Christ was born;
O night divine, O Holy Night!

Fall on your knees! Oh, hear the angel voices!
O night divine, o night when Christ was born;
O night divine, O Holy Night!
